I'll try to give as much info as i can so it will be easier to determine the problem.
My problem is that when i try to overclock my CPU it resets back to default clock settings after a reboot.
I started by just changing the multiplier from x33 to x39 in BIOS and left the rest of the clock settings at default. After i saved and booted into windows it was running fine at 3.9GHz for the 10 or so hours i had my computer running. Once i shut down and woke up the next morning and booted up my motherboard detected "a problem with the overclock settings" and will restore to the default clock settings.
My CPU is a i5 2500k , i have a 700w power supply and my motherboard is this one http://www.gigabyte.us/products/product-page.aspx?pid=4015#ov
It is running BIOS version FB, 2 versions behind.... I DO NOT WANT TO FLASH BIOS IF UNNECESSARY. I want to determine if there is another problem causing this before flashing bios.

Solution


Have you tried raising your Vcore voltage yet? It may help. Try 1.250 v.
